UWP版VPN应用的兴起与网络工程师视角下的安全挑战解析

hjs7784 2026-02-04 vpn加速器 2 0

随着Windows 10和Windows 11生态系统的不断演进,通用Windows平台(Universal Windows Platform, UWP)逐渐成为微软官方推荐的应用开发框架,近年来,越来越多的虚拟私人网络(VPN)服务开始推出UWP版本,以适配现代Windows设备并提升用户体验,作为网络工程师,我们不仅要关注这些新应用带来的便利性,更要深入分析其底层架构、数据传输机制以及潜在的安全风险。

UWP版VPN相较于传统桌面应用(如Win32或.NET Framework开发的程序)具有显著优势,它运行在沙盒环境中,权限受控,系统资源占用更低,且能更好地与Windows 10/11的隐私设置、网络策略集成,微软内置的“Windows Defender Application Control”和“AppLocker”策略可以更精细地控制UWP应用的行为,这对企业级部署尤其重要,UWP应用通常通过Microsoft Store分发,这为应用审核和版本更新提供了统一入口,有助于减少恶意软件传播的风险。

从网络工程的角度看,UWP版VPN也带来新的挑战,第一,UWP应用对底层网络接口的访问受限,很多功能依赖于Windows提供的抽象API(如Windows.Networking.Connectivity),这意味着其加密隧道可能无法完全自定义协议栈,比如不支持OpenVPN或WireGuard的某些高级配置选项,第二,由于UWP应用运行在受限沙盒中,调试和日志记录变得困难,当出现连接中断或性能问题时,传统的tcpdump或Wireshark抓包手段可能无法直接捕获UWP进程的流量,增加了故障排查的复杂度。

更值得关注的是安全层面,虽然UWP应用本身具备更高的安全性基线,但部分第三方UWP版VPN可能未正确实现证书验证、密钥交换或DNS泄漏防护机制,有研究发现某些UWP应用在切换网络环境(如从Wi-Fi到蜂窝数据)时未重新建立加密通道,导致敏感信息暴露,UWP应用若未正确处理用户权限升级(如管理员权限请求),可能被恶意利用进行横向移动攻击。

作为网络工程师,在部署UWP版VPN前应执行以下操作:

  1. 使用Network Monitor或Windows Event Log审查应用行为;
  2. 配置组策略(GPO)限制UWP应用的网络访问范围;
  3. 对比测试UWP与传统客户端的延迟、吞吐量和稳定性;
  4. 定期检查Microsoft Store中的应用更新,确保补丁及时应用。

UWP版VPN是技术进步的体现,但其安全性和可控性仍需网络工程师保持警惕,唯有深入理解其架构逻辑,结合企业网络策略,才能真正发挥其价值,同时规避潜在风险。

UWP版VPN应用的兴起与网络工程师视角下的安全挑战解析